A charming two bedroom first floor apartment within a former School, offering rooftop garden with stunning Abbey views, lift service, garage and parking. Offered with a no onward chain!


This splendid first floor apartment was converted in the late 1990's, formerly a Catholic School House built in the late 19th Century. The building hosts plenty of character and space with the huge benefit of not being listed.  The property forms one of only 5 apartments in the building and has been well maintained and cared for by the current vendors with a serviced gas fired central heating system and modern electrics. A grand and most welcoming communal entrance hall greets you, with intercom entry system and both stairs and serviced lift providing access to the apartment on the first floor.   The proportions of the apartment are excellent, with a plentiful supply of natural light and wonderful views towards both the Sherborne Abbey and Honeycombe Woods.  The bedrooms and living accommodation are cleverly separate by the entrance hall, off of which is access to both the cloakroom and separate jack and Jill shower room.  This Art Nouveau suite comprises a generous walk in twin head shower with Mackintosh tiled surround, pedestal sink, heated towel rail and wc.  The principal bedroom has direct access to the bathroom and is of generous proportions with most appealing balcony an seating area.  The second double bedroom can also be used as a study or dining room.  Set across the hallway is the living accommodation, with a focal sitting room positioned around a feature fireplace with gas fire inset and double doors leading out onto a wonderful roof top garden, a perfect private place to relax and enjoy the wonderful town and countryside vista.  The kitchen has been tastefully designed with a 1950’s style in mind. Dual aspect sash windows provide an outlook towards Honeycombe Woods, with a plentiful supply of units and wooden worktops.  The kitchen is fitted with a SMEG oven, Belling 4 ring gas hob and extractor hood, with a host of under counter space for white goods.

St Antony’s School House, lies a short walk of the main thoroughfare of Cheap Street to the centre of the historic Abbey town of Sherborne. Within walking distance of the town’s amenities which include the Abbey, a main line station, two supermarkets, three doctors’ surgeries and a comprehensive range of shops, public houses and restaurants. Sporting, walking and riding opportunities abound within the area with golf clubs at both Sherborne and Yeovil while the region is well known for both its public and privately funded schools. Communication links are the main line station linking directly with London Waterloo while road links are along the A303 joined at Wincanton.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
